Skirball Talks

Skirball Talks is a new series, featuring compelling and challenging thought leaders from the worlds of the arts, entertainment, media and politics. The series is free and open to the public. Skirball Talks launched on September 25, 2017 with author Ta-Nehisi Coates; the inaugural season also featured Tony Kushner, Lisa Kron, Slavoj Žižek, and Judith Butler.

The Skirball Talks series is made possible in part by a Humanities New York Action Grant and by the New York State Council on the Arts with the support of Governor Andrew M. Cuomo and the New York State Legislature.

NT Live

National Theater Live returns to NYU Skirball with screenings of acclaimed theater from the London Stage. Launched in 2009, National Theatre Live broadcasts have been seen by an audience of over 5 million people at 2000 venues in 50 countries.
